Understanding Payoneer Capital Advance
Payoneer Capital Advance is a financial solution designed for freelancers and businesses that allows them to access funds in advance based on their expected earnings. This can be particularly useful for freelancers who may have irregular income streams and need quick access to cash for business expenses, investments, or personal needs.
Why Payoneer is Essential for Pakistani Freelancers
As a Pakistani Freelancer, you face unique challenges when it comes to receiving payments. Here are some key points to consider:
- PayPal is Not Available: Many international clients prefer to use PayPal, but since it doesn’t operate in Pakistan, freelancers need to find alternative payment solutions.
- Access to International Markets: Payoneer allows you to receive payments from clients worldwide, making it easier to expand your freelancing business.
- Localized Banking Options: Payoneer works seamlessly with Pakistani banks like HBL, MCB, and UBL, facilitating easy withdrawals in PKR.
- Mobile Wallet Integration: You can link Payoneer with mobile wallets like JazzCash and Easypaisa, making it easy to manage your funds.
How to Access Payoneer Capital Advance
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to access Payoneer Capital Advance:
Step 1: Sign Up for Payoneer
If you haven’t already, sign up for a Payoneer account. You can do this by visiting Payoneer’s website. Make sure to provide accurate information during the registration process to avoid any issues later.
Step 2: Build Your Payment History
To be eligible for Capital Advance, you need to have a history of receiving payments through Payoneer. Aim to receive payments from various clients over a period of time to establish a reliable track record.
Step 3: Check Your Eligibility
Payoneer evaluates eligibility based on your payment history and account activity. Generally, freelancers who have received consistent payments for at least six months are considered for Capital Advance.
Step 4: Apply for Capital Advance
Once you meet the eligibility criteria, you can apply for a Capital Advance directly through your Payoneer account dashboard. The system will guide you through the application process.
Step 5: Receive Your Funds
If approved, you will receive the funds directly into your Payoneer account. You can then withdraw the amount through your linked bank account, or use it for business expenses.
Pros and Cons of Payoneer Capital Advance
Like any financial product, Payoneer Capital Advance comes with its own set of advantages and disadvantages:
Pros
- Quick access to funds to manage cash flow.
- Flexible repayment options based on your earning schedule.
- Helps freelancers invest in their business or cover unexpected expenses.
Cons
- Not all freelancers may qualify for Capital Advance.
- Fees may apply, which can reduce the total amount received.
- Repayment is based on future earnings, which may be unpredictable.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does Payoneer work in Pakistan?
Yes, Payoneer works perfectly in Pakistan. You can receive payments from Fiverr, Upwork, and other platforms to Payoneer and transfer to your Pakistani bank.
How do I transfer from Payoneer to Pakistani bank?
Log into Payoneer, select Withdraw > To Bank Account, choose your Pakistani bank, enter amount. Funds arrive in 2-5 business days.
What are Payoneer fees?
Payoneer charges about 2% for withdrawal to Pakistani banks. ATM withdrawal costs $3.15. Currency conversion has a 2% fee.
